String compression algorithm java. " + "The result will be smaller than this string.
String compression algorithm java When you see a new letter put what you have counted onto the output and set the new letter as what you have last seen. Append the picked character to the destination string. Java; kiwamizamurai / lzstring_ruby. This is an experienced java interview question for 4-6 years developers. While word is not empty, use the following operation: * Remove a maximum length prefix of word made of a single character c repeating at most 9 times. Sep 24, 2022 ยท The decoded string is: Huffman coding is a data compression algorithm. For each group of consecutive repeating characters in chars: If the group’s length is 1, append the character to s. It works by assigning the variable-length codes to the input characters with the shorter codes assigned to the more frequent characters. One common approach is to use the Run-Length Encoding (RLE) algorithm. By following the steps outlined in this tutorial, you've learned how to compress and decompress strings effectively using Java. kbbyx hzx kxzpon vvpvzlrq wluzvx nmiffi zppd xwcg hjhqrys gqkoqet